Hola:
Para evitar usar un identificador (id), puede ser algo complejo porque algunas cosas, cada navegador las interpreta a su manera.
Con el DOM existe createElement/insertBefore/appendChild, pero si se trata de alguna estructura algo compleja, aún pudiéndose, supongo que sería complicado, así que como respuesta sencilla, lo mejor es innerHTML pero con la sintaxis de añadidura...
document.body.innerHTML += "un añadido...";
Saludos